Abstract


The article is a study of the use of admiratio to display the new American reality at the end of the fourteenth and into the fifteenth century. After exploring the semantic wealth of the term and defining it, we will present it as the first stage of the cognitive process of the human being, whose object will be Nature, understood as a whole entity in which men are included. The depiction of the admirable thing as a part of the cognitive process will also have its place in this study. But it is under the renovation that proposed the Renaissance, when admiratio turned into a poetic function related to that of movere, solving America as inventio the problem of verisimilitude inherited from the Middle Ages. Then, this concept will be used by our authors, not only to reflect a stage of knowledge, but with a clearly rhetorical function: to create a specific state of mind in the reader in order to obtain something from him.
